NHL Attendance
- 2015-16 Season
- Ranked by Average
- 30 Teams
Rk | Team | Arena | Avg. | Cap. | % Cap | Total |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
1 | Chicago Blackhawks | United Center | 21,859 | 19,717 | 110.9% | 896,240 |
2 | Montreal Canadiens | Bell Centre | 21,288 | 21,273 | 100.1% | 872,808 |
3 | Detroit Red Wings | Joe Louis Arena | 19,827 | 20,027 | 99.0% | 821,107 |
4 | Minnesota Wild | Xcel Energy Center | 19,827 | 17,954 | 110.4% | 812,907 |
5 | Philadelphia Flyers | Wells Fargo Center | 19,227 | 19,541 | 98.4% | 788,319 |
6 | Toronto Maple Leafs | Air Canada Centre | 19,158 | 18,819 | 101.8% | 785,485 |
7 | Calgary Flames | Scotiabank Saddledome | 19,145 | 19,289 | 99.3% | 784,974 |
8 | Tampa Bay Lightning | Amalie Arena | 19,092 | 19,204 | 99.4% | 782,772 |
9 | Boston Bruins | TD Garden | 18,776 | 17,565 | 106.9% | 769,846 |
10 | Buffalo Sabres | First Niagara Center | 18,590 | 19,070 | 97.5% | 762,223 |
11 | Pittsburgh Penguins | Consol Energy Center | 18,550 | 18,387 | 100.9% | 760,584 |
12 | Washington Capitals | Verizon Center | 18,510 | 18,506 | 100.0% | 758,944 |
13 | St. Louis Blues | Scottrade Center | 18,450 | 19,150 | 96.3% | 756,483 |
14 | Vancouver Canucks | Rogers Arena | 18,431 | 18,910 | 97.5% | 755,677 |
15 | Dallas Stars | American Airlines Center | 18,376 | 18,532 | 99.2% | 753,452 |
16 | Los Angeles Kings | Staples Center | 18,274 | 18,230 | 100.2% | 749,234 |
17 | Ottawa Senators | Canadian Tire Centre | 18,084 | 19,153 | 94.4% | 741,472 |
18 | New York Rangers | MSG | 18,006 | 18,006 | 100.0% | 738,246 |
19 | Colorado Avalanche | Pepsi Center | 17,032 | 18,007 | 94.6% | 698,327 |
20 | Nashville Predators | Bridgestone Arena | 16,971 | 17,113 | 99.2% | 695,828 |
21 | Edmonton Oilers | Rexall Place | 16,841 | 16,839 | 100.0% | 690,499 |
22 | San Jose Sharks | SAP Center | 16,746 | 17,562 | 95.4% | 686,723 |
23 | Anaheim Ducks | Honda Center | 16,336 | 17,174 | 95.1% | 669,805 |
24 | Florida Panthers | BB& T Center | 15,384 | 19,250 | 79.9% | 630,746 |
25 | Winnipeg Jets | MTS Centre | 15,294 | 15,016 | 101.9% | 627,054 |
26 | New Jersey Devils | Prudential Center | 15,073 | 16,514 | 91.3% | 618,029 |
27 | Columbus Blue Jackets | Nationwide Arena | 14,665 | 18,500 | 79.3% | 601,293 |
28 | New York Islanders | Barclay Center | 13,626 | 15,795 | 86.3% | 558,705 |
29 | Arizona Coyotes | Gila River Arena | 13,433 | 17,125 | 78.4% | 550,763 |
30 | Carolina Hurricanes | PNC Arena | 12,203 | 18,680 | 65.3% | 500,363 |
Average | 17,569 | 18,297 | 96.0% | 21,618,908 |
Avg: Average Attendance (41 Games) | Cap: Capacity | % Cap: Percentage of Capacity | Total: 41 Home Games added up
Note: Capacity for Hockey Seating Only. The 21,618,908 is the Total Sum and not an Average.
